The Save for Later area within the Tentacles Marketplace is a container where you can store products that you have found and like but do not have an immediate need for or use. Instead of having to write down URLs to remember what products you like for later use, Tentacles has the ability to store these products in a way that associates them with your TurboSquid user account name. Every time you log into Tentacles, those files will be present within the Save for Later area.

There are a number of ways to get products you find through Marketplace searches into your Save for Later area.

 

First, when previewing a product within a search, you have the ability to Add to Cart, or Save For Later.

Clicking on Save For Later will open up the Save for Later container and drop the product in for future reference.

 

A second way to add products to Save for Later is to click the button associated in a main search result.

The last way you can add a product to your Save for Later container is from within the Shopping Cart area of Tentacles.

Any item that is within your Shopping cart can also be moved at any time to your Save for Later container simply by clicking on the button within the shopping cart.
